A generic lubricating device is apparent from DE 10 2008 024 514 B4. This lubrication system has the advantage of producing no oil film or oil mist in the area of the injection molding machine. By avoiding a permanent oil flow, energy can be saved and the wear of the seals of the lubricant circuit can be greatly reduced. Due to the parallel supply of the lubrication points a uniform distribution of the lubricant is achieved at the lubrication points, without having to ensure a consistently high pressure such as in a pressure circulation lubrication. In DE 10 2008 024 514 B4, the container into which the lubricant runs after lubrication of the lubricating parts is viewed in a vertical plane (section of FIG. 1 of DE 10 2008 024 514 B4) in the vertical direction below all lubricating parts. It has been found that this arrangement can lead to an undesirably high outflow of lubricant from the lubricating parts. The object of the invention is to prevent an undesirable high outflow of lubricant from the lubricating parts in a generic lubricating device. This object is achieved by a lubricating device having the features of claim 1. The biasing of the located in each drain line lubricant in the area of each lubrication point against the drainage direction prevents excessive Abfiießen lubricant from the lubricating parts. The bias voltage can be generated in many ways. If one arranges the collecting container for the running lubricant considered in the vertical direction higher than the highest lubrication point, which is connected via a drain line with the collecting container, resulting from the weight of the lubricant column in the collecting container or that line piece, which is located above the highest lubrication point , a sufficient hydrostatic pressure to generate the bias voltage. For example, an arrangement of the collecting container of about 10 centimeters above the highest lubrication point is sufficient. Often a deeper arrangement will be sufficient, this can be easily determined by experiments. Alternatively, instead of a collecting container, a collection tube with a sufficiently large diameter could be provided into which the discharge lines lead. In this case, the point of confluence in the vertical direction is considered to be higher than the highest Schmlerstelle, which is connected via a drain line to the manifold. Instead of making use of the hydrostatic principle, provision can be made for a limiting valve or a check valve to be arranged in each discharge line or in a collecting line into which the discharge lines terminate. Also by this measure, a sufficient bias voltage can be generated. It may be provided to arrange the valves directly at each lubrication point. Although this means increased design effort, but has the advantage that you can choose the extent of bias for each lubrication point individually. Of course, the above measures can also be provided in any combination. Apart from the measures according to the invention, the lubricating device may otherwise be formed as in DE 10 2008 024 514 B4. A preferred embodiment provides that the lubricant runs without pressure up to the bias against the drainage direction from the lubrication point via the drain line into the container. A major advantage is that not the entire lubricant circuit is under pressure. Specifically, although the supply of the lubricant to the lubrication points is carried out under a certain pressure, the lubricant recirculation takes place in the above sense, however, without pressure. Mainly, this will be done in the lubrication point, but can also be completely reduced in the supply line, if any pressure built up, as well as a pressureless supply is possible only by the action of gravity. Essentially, the pressure reduction depends on the diameter of the entire lubricant circuit. With decreasing diameter, the pressure is higher, whereas with increasing diameter of the pressure reduction takes place faster until the lubricant even runs without pressure in the lubricant circuit. According to the figures in the figures given later, the bearing gap forms this narrowest stiffness, whereby after passing through this lubrication point a substantial part of the pressure reduction takes place, since the drain line again has a larger diameter and thus allows a higher flow. According to one embodiment of the lubricating device, the lubrication point is located between a lever, preferably a toggle lever, and a bolt. These lubrication points are located in the area around the bolt, where the toggle lever are mounted (in Fig. 1, for example, six lubrication points are shown). Another application example may be the spindle lubrication. Furthermore, it is advantageous if the lubrication point is sealed by sealing rings. By this sealing no lubricant can escape from the joint, which is especially for the use of injection molding in clean rooms as mentioned of great advantage. It has proven to be particularly advantageous if the lubricating device is preferably provided exclusively for heavily loaded lubrication points of lever joints. This means that not only a lubricant seal can be present in an injection molding machine. Especially with highly stressed joint lubrication of injection molding machines, it is often necessary that the highly stressed areas get their own lubrication. In order to meet the various requirements, different and independent lubrication systems are advantageous in one and the same injection molding machine. Furthermore, it has proven to be particularly advantageous if the lubricant is a lubricating oil, fluid grease or the like. The advantages of circulation lubrication are - as already mentioned - in the return of the lubricating oil and thus in its reuse and non-leakage of the lubricant from the lubrication points or joints. Such circulation lubrication may comprise a container which is designed as a lubricant reservoir, from which lubricant can be re-introduced into the circuit, for example by the pump. In this case, the lubricating device may have a lubricant filter in the drain line. Before reintroducing the lubricant into the lubricant circuit, this lubricant filter will filter the abrasion and residue left in the lubrication points out of the lubricant. A particular further embodiment provides that the lubricating device is designed as a consumption lubrication. However, this can only be compared indirectly with a conventional consumption lubrication since the lubricant does not escape from the joints. The lubrication points are sealed by sealing rings, with the drain points leading out of the lubrication points. In contrast to circulation lubrication, however, this lubricated lubricant is no longer reintroduced into the lubricant circulation in the case of consumption lubrication, but may for example have at least two containers, one serving as a lubricant reservoir and one as a collecting container for lubricant. From the lubricant reservoir, the lubricant is supplied via the Zuiaufleitung to the lubrication points and then collected in a collecting container. This collecting container replaced in this case, so to speak, the drip pan, which is in conventional injection molding machines under the entire injection molding machine, whereby an injection molding machine can be used even when used as a consumption lubrication in clean rooms. The Abiauffeitung can be designed as a manifold. Both in circulation lubrication as well as consumption lubrication, it is advantageous if the individual drain lines from the various lubrication points open into a manifold. With circulating lubrication, this manifold could flow directly into the lubricant pump in order to run through the cycle again. The intermediate container 2 'is provided with an aerator 15. This ensures that only up to the level shown in Fig. 2 lubricant 4 is present as a contiguous column in the drain line 3 and the intermediate container 2 '. If one did not provide an aerator 15, then it could happen that the line leading from the intermediate container 2 'to the collecting container 2 also has a continuous lubricant column, which would only more than result in an undesirable suction effect. This principle is also based on the embodiment of FIG. 3. Here open the drain lines 3 as a manifold into a manifold 16, which has such a large diameter that in the manifold 16 no continuous Schmiemnittelsäufe more is given. For this purpose, the collecting container 2 is again provided with an aerator 15. In the embodiments 4, 5a and 5b, the bias is effected by the arrangement of valves. 4, a limiting valve 17 is provided as a valve. According to Fig. 5a, a check valve 18 is provided as a valve. In the embodiment of FIG. 5b, each lubrication point 11 is assigned a valve 18 directly. This allows an individual vote at each lubrication point 11 done. The principle of Fig, 5b would of course be feasible with check valves 18, which is expensive.
